Tips to Reduce Junk Mail
If you're plagued by junk mail, unwanted catalogs and/or donation solicitations, these steps can help! First, I recommend signing up with these organizations to be removed from junk mail lists - I use all of them and love them. www.DMAChoice.org - to get off mailing and email lists. A Donation Station Makes it Easy to Declutter Every Day
A simple tip to get unwanted items out of our living spaces. The Donation Station is one of my absolute favorite simple clutter solutions! A Donation Station is a consistent, designated, easy-to-access but out-of-the way place to put things we come across on a daily basis that we don't want-use-need-love. How many times do we walk by, move, touch or look at things we don't want in our homes, garages, cupboards and closets? These items can clutter our physical and mental space
